If the car was manufactured before 1 January 1992 and the maker hasn't defined an optimum hauling ability, use these pulling capabilities as a guide:1.5 times the unloaded mass of the vehicleif the trailer is fitted with appropriate brakesa maximum of 750kgif the trailer isn't fitted with brakes.

You may tow only 1 trailer (campers, box or boat) at a time. When lugging a trailer (consisting of caravans), keep in mind to: enable for the added size and width of the trailer when entering trafficallow for its tendency to 'cut in' on edges and curvesaccelerate, brake and guide smoothly and gently to prevent swayingallow for the effects of cross-winds, passing traffic and irregular roadway surfacesleave a longer stopping distance between you and the automobile ahead; boost the space for longer, much heavier trailers and enable also much more distance in inadequate driving conditionsuse a lower equipment in both hand-operated and automatic cars when travelling downhill to make your automobile simpler to regulate and minimize the strain on your brakesallow more time and range to overtake and stay clear of 'reducing off' the automobile you are overtaking when returning to the left lanefit a reversing electronic camera or obtain a person to watch the rear of the trailer when you reversereversing is challenging and takes practicenot hold up trafficpull off the road where it is risk-free to do so, and where it will not create a build-up of web traffic incapable to overtakebe aware that your car and trailer will have a tendency to sway when a heavy vehicle surpasses you. A trailer with one axle group near his explanation the middle of the load. Part of the tons hinges on the tow drawback of the lugging lorry. A trailer with 2 axle teams. The front axle team is steered by connection to the tow automobile. Most of the load rests on the trailer.

The tow drawback is in front of the back axle of the tow vehicle. It's essential to pick the ideal trailer kind and setup for simpler tons circulation and restriction. Your automobile requires to be geared up properly for the trailer's kind and dimension, consisting of: tow bars and couplings of an ideal type and capacityelectrical sockets for lightingsuitable brake links if requiredextra mirrors for pulling large trailers if requiredoptional rear-view camerathese help to see web traffic behind you but do not replace the need for mirrors.
